Incorporate soft fabric panels, textured wall decals, and safe sensory boards with varied materials like fleece, rubber, or sandpaper. These surfaces invite little hands to explore differences in texture, building sensory awareness while encouraging fine motor development. Use non-toxic, washable finishes to ensure safety and durability.

Integrate gentle sound elements such as fabric wind chimes, soft chimes, or a small musical mobile to gently engage auditory senses. Pair these with dimmable LED lights or fiber-optic star ceilings that mimic night skies—creating a peaceful, immersive atmosphere that supports emotional regulation and sleep readiness.

Use low-glare, high-contrast colors and soft lighting to create a visually engaging environment. Include a dedicated sensory bin station with rice, beans, or water beads (supervised) and safe props like squishy toys and textured blocks. These elements promote cognitive exploration and hand-eye coordination in a safe, contained space.

These rooms are particularly beneficial for toddlers and children with sensory processing issues, autism, ADHD, or anxiety. The goal is to create a space where your child can engage with various sensory stimuli in a safe and enjoyable way. A sensory room is a specially designed space that provides a variety of sensory experiences to help individuals, especially children, regulate their sensory input.
